Joint pain after chikungunya is greater than only a lingering discomfort; it could turn out to be a persistent subject, lasting weeks and even months after the fever subsides. The pain happens due to irritation brought on by the viral an infection and generally impacts joints like wrists, ankles, and knees. While preliminary relaxation is critical, extreme inactivity can lead to stiffness and decreased mobility. Effective restoration depends on a balanced strategy that features mild motion, soothing therapies, anti-inflammatory diet, and correct self-care. With the correct methods, it’s doable to ease discomfort, restore joint flexibility, and stop long-term issues after chikungunya.
Why chikungunya causes joint pain
Chikungunya joint pain just isn’t merely a symptom of fatigue, it is a results of irritation that lingers lengthy after restoration. Typically, the virus triggers an inflammatory response in joints, inflicting swelling, stiffness, and discomfort that will persist for months and even years.Recognising that it is a post-viral phenomenon, not simply weak spot, is vital for efficient administration and avoiding pointless immobilisation.
Practical tips to reduce post-chikungunya joint pain
1. Gentle motion and physiotherapyStaying lively is important to forestall stiffness from getting worse:
- Avoid extended relaxation: Complete mattress relaxation weakens muscle groups and delays therapeutic.
- Start gradual: Begin with primary range-of-motion workouts akin to wrist rotations, ankle circles, and knee bends.
- Try yoga: Gentle yoga postures like Tadasana (Mountain Pose) and Sukhasana (Easy Pose) can reduce stiffness.
- Physiotherapy: If pain is extreme, seek the advice of a physiotherapist for a structured rehabilitation program that features stretching and strengthening workouts.
2. Home-based pain relief strategiesNatural cures can complement restoration:
- Hot compress: Apply heat towels or heating pads for 10–quarter-hour to loosen up stiff muscle groups.
- Cold remedy: Use ice packs to reduce swelling throughout flare-ups.
- Herbal therapeutic massage oils: Massage with turmeric-infused sesame oil or eucalyptus oil to ease stiffness and enhance blood circulation.
- Anti-inflammatory meals: Turmeric, ginger, and garlic have pure anti-inflammatory properties, embrace them in teas or meals.
- Omega-3 wealthy meals: Flax seeds, walnuts, chia seeds, and fish assist reduce systemic irritation.
